Output 1adbbd8fb2cb8857ddf952a826d5cc28b862edc98a4e3dbfcba0edeeb0ee7360:1

value
32095418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d050ea13f58fa424ddde3a020f4e54c57243d7b OP_EQUAL
address
3BdTdq6bzHFc5pxtmydFijbZ1ZTagaBWxv
transaction
1adbbd8fb2cb8857ddf952a826d5cc28b862edc98a4e3dbfcba0edeeb0ee7360
confirmations
384353
spent
true